Here are the step-by-step solutions for adding the fractions. To add fractions with different bottom numbers (denominators), we first need to find a common denominator that all the numbers can divide into evenly. Then, we change each fraction so they all have that same bottom number, add the top numbers (numerators), and simplify if needed.
1) $\frac{3}{4} + \frac{3}{5} + \frac{1}{3}$
* The least common multiple for 4, 5, and 3 is 60.
* Convert fractions: $\frac{3 \times 15}{60} + \frac{3 \times 12}{60} + \frac{1 \times 20}{60}$
* This becomes: $\frac{45}{60} + \frac{36}{60} + \frac{20}{60}$
* Add numerators: $45 + 36 + 20 = 101$
* Result: $\frac{101}{60}$ or $1 \frac{41}{60}$
2) $\frac{2}{3} + \frac{4}{5} + \frac{2}{4}$
* First, simplify $\frac{2}{4}$ to $\frac{1}{2}$. Now we have $\frac{2}{3} + \frac{4}{5} + \frac{1}{2}$.
* The least common multiple for 3, 5, and 2 is 30.
* Convert fractions: $\frac{2 \times 10}{30} + \frac{4 \times 6}{30} + \frac{1 \times 15}{30}$
* This becomes: $\frac{20}{30} + \frac{24}{30} + \frac{15}{30}$
* Add numerators: $20 + 24 + 15 = 59$
* Result: $\frac{59}{30}$ or $1 \frac{29}{30}$
3) $\frac{2}{4} + \frac{2}{5} + \frac{2}{10}$
* Simplify $\frac{2}{4}$ to $\frac{1}{2}$ and $\frac{2}{10}$ to $\frac{1}{5}$.
* Now we have: $\frac{1}{2} + \frac{2}{5} + \frac{1}{5}$.
* Combine the fifths: $\frac{2}{5} + \frac{1}{5} = \frac{3}{5}$.
* Now add $\frac{1}{2} + \frac{3}{5}$. Common denominator is 10.
* Convert: $\frac{5}{10} + \frac{6}{10} = \frac{11}{10}$
* Result: $\frac{11}{10}$ or $1 \frac{1}{10}$
4) $\frac{7}{10} + \frac{2}{3} + \frac{1}{5}$
* The least common multiple for 10, 3, and 5 is 30.
* Convert fractions: $\frac{7 \times 3}{30} + \frac{2 \times 10}{30} + \frac{1 \times 6}{30}$
* This becomes: $\frac{21}{30} + \frac{20}{30} + \frac{6}{30}$
* Add numerators: $21 + 20 + 6 = 47$
* Result: $\frac{47}{30}$ or $1 \frac{17}{30}$
5) $\frac{3}{4} + \frac{1}{2} + \frac{1}{10}$
* The least common multiple for 4, 2, and 10 is 20.
* Convert fractions: $\frac{3 \times 5}{20} + \frac{1 \times 10}{20} + \frac{1 \times 2}{20}$
* This becomes: $\frac{15}{20} + \frac{10}{20} + \frac{2}{20}$
* Add numerators: $15 + 10 + 2 = 27$
* Result: $\frac{27}{20}$ or $1 \frac{7}{20}$
6) $\frac{8}{10} + \frac{1}{2} + \frac{2}{4}$
* Simplify fractions: $\frac{8}{10} = \frac{4}{5}$, $\frac{2}{4} = \frac{1}{2}$.
* Now we have: $\frac{4}{5} + \frac{1}{2} + \frac{1}{2}$.
* Add the halves: $\frac{1}{2} + \frac{1}{2} = 1$.
* Now add $\frac{4}{5} + 1$.
* Result: $1 \frac{4}{5}$ (or $\frac{9}{5}$)
7) $\frac{2}{5} + \frac{7}{10} + \frac{3}{4}$
* The least common multiple for 5, 10, and 4 is 20.
* Convert fractions: $\frac{2 \times 4}{20} + \frac{7 \times 2}{20} + \frac{3 \times 5}{20}$
* This becomes: $\frac{8}{20} + \frac{14}{20} + \frac{15}{20}$
* Add numerators: $8 + 14 + 15 = 37$
* Result: $\frac{37}{20}$ or $1 \frac{17}{20}$
8) $\frac{5}{10} + \frac{1}{4} + \frac{1}{5}$
* Simplify $\frac{5}{10}$ to $\frac{1}{2}$.
* Now we have: $\frac{1}{2} + \frac{1}{4} + \frac{1}{5}$.
* The least common multiple for 2, 4, and 5 is 20.
* Convert fractions: $\frac{1 \times 10}{20} + \frac{1 \times 5}{20} + \frac{1 \times 4}{20}$
* This becomes: $\frac{10}{20} + \frac{5}{20} + \frac{4}{20}$
* Add numerators: $10 + 5 + 4 = 19$
* Result: $\frac{19}{20}$
9) $\frac{4}{5} + \frac{4}{10} + \frac{1}{2}$
* Simplify $\frac{4}{10}$ to $\frac{2}{5}$. Note that $\frac{1}{2}$ is equal to $\frac{5}{10}$ or $\frac{2.5}{5}$, but let's use 10 as the common denominator for easier math.
* Convert $\frac{4}{5}$ to $\frac{8}{10}$ and $\frac{1}{2}$ to $\frac{5}{10}$.
* Now we have: $\frac{8}{10} + \frac{4}{10} + \frac{5}{10}$
* Add numerators: $8 + 4 + 5 = 17$
* Result: $\frac{17}{10}$ or $1 \frac{7}{10}$
10) $\frac{3}{5} + \frac{3}{4} + \frac{6}{10}$
* Simplify $\frac{6}{10}$ to $\frac{3}{5}$.
* Now we have: $\frac{3}{5} + \frac{3}{4} + \frac{3}{5}$.
* Combine the fifths: $\frac{3}{5} + \frac{3}{5} = \frac{6}{5}$.
* Now add $\frac{6}{5} + \frac{3}{4}$. Common denominator is 20.
* Convert: $\frac{6 \times 4}{20} + \frac{3 \times 5}{20} = \frac{24}{20} + \frac{15}{20}$
* Add numerators: $24 + 15 = 39$
* Result: $\frac{39}{20}$ or $1 \frac{19}{20}$
Final Answer:
1) $1 \frac{41}{60}$
2) $1 \frac{29}{30}$
3) $1 \frac{1}{10}$
4) $1 \frac{17}{30}$
5) $1 \frac{7}{20}$
6) $1 \frac{4}{5}$
7) $1 \frac{17}{20}$
8) $\frac{19}{20}$
9) $1 \frac{7}{10}$
10) $1 \frac{19}{20}$
